...
The figure below illustrates the Component Property Sheet (CPS) panel with Expert Properties view enabled.
Figure 1: Component Configuration properties for S3Upload
...
Select this option for the server to encrypt the data before storing in the bucket.
Server Server Encryption Mode
This option appears only when Server Side Encryption? property is selected. In this case, Amazon S3 manages the keys required for encrypting by itself.
File Name Prefix
The specified prefix is prepended to the uploaded file.
Storage Mode
The current API provides three modes of Storage classes.
- STANDARD: Default storage class; this storage class is ideal for performance-sensitive use cases and frequently accessed data.
- Standard Infrequent Access (Standard - IA): Amazon S3 Standard - Infrequent Access (Standard - IA) is an Amazon S3 storage class for data that is accessed less frequently, but requires rapid access when needed.
- Reduced Redundancy: The Reduced Redundancy Storage (RRS) storage class is designed for noncritical, reproducible data stored at lower levels of redundancy than the STANDARD storage class, which reduces storage costs.
File Name Prefix
The specified prefix is prepended to the uploaded file.
Correlation Id Property
Specify the Correlation Id message property name. The input messages will be grouped based on the correlation Id property. Messages which has the same property value will be treated as a single file. This value is appended to the FileNamePrefix property, if specified, and treated as the file name.
...
Specifies the Bucket name property name. Bucket name can be provided from the input whose value takes precedence over the one provided in CPS.
Is Message Headers a priority?
Considers Message Headers prior to the message.
Sequence Number Property
This property is used to identify duplicate sequence numbers; discards the duplicate input arrived at its input port.
...